Action item from the Mirewater tide-table widget incident. Owner: release manager. Widget cached stale harbor offsets after the DST change, showing tides six hours off for two days. Required: add a cache-invalidation check to the release checklist, block deploys when offset tables are older than 24 hours, and verify the Saltgate harbor feed before each cut. Deadline: next release. Checklist template and sign-off procedure are documented on the internal page below.

wiki page, kawif-bajep: https://artifactory.zarqelforge.internal/issue/browse/display/display/projects/spaces/secrets/000fe6ec5a46af29355003e1

## PointsLedger: plugin basics

Welcome! Before your plugin can post or reverse entries on the Tallyjar loyalty-points ledger, it needs to register a handler and respect the idempotency window — double-credits make the support folks grumpy. Stick to the sandbox tenant until your validation suite passes. Everything your plugin reads at startup comes from the shared config bundle, and for reference the current values are shown here.

settings of fafog-haduf:
ZORIX_PIN=4648
ZORIX_METRICS_HOST=metrics.zorix.paliqsys.corp
ZORIX_LOG_LEVEL=info
ZORIX_TENANT=druix

Subject: DR drill — Brickline incremental rebuilds

Drill is Tuesday 09:00. Scope: the Brickline pipeline that does incremental static site rebuilds for the Coppervale docs portal. We'll wipe the rebuild cache, sever the artifact store, and confirm full-rebuild fallback completes under twenty minutes. Reviewers: check the fallback branch before Monday; no merges after noon. The standby artifact store starts sealed. Whoever runs the drill unseals it with the recovery passphrase below.

vault phrase of tajop-haduf = holath-brivan-wenax

## Changelog — Font vendoring defaults changed

As of this release, the Bracken UI build no longer fetches third-party fonts at build time. All typefaces used by the Lanternwell suite are now vendored into the repo under a dedicated assets directory, and the fetch step is skipped by default. If you're onboarding, nothing to install — the fonts travel with the checkout. The build flags controlling this behavior are listed below.

settings of hadup-yafog:
LAMAEL_PIN=3761
LAMAEL_TENANT=istmir
LAMAEL_METRICS_HOST=metrics.lamael.plorvasys.test
LAMAEL_SEAL=seal_8ea68500
LAMAEL_STANDBY_TEAM=fraok